MARTIN — Montori Hughes was easily the largest person in the room during UT Martin's weekly press conference on Monday.
But when offered some of the pizza and hot wings set out for media and personnel, Hughes passed up on the lunch that he might have feasted on a few months ago.
"It's part of my transition here to get back into shape and get back to where I can play to my top performance," Hughes said.
Hughes, a former defensive lineman at Tennessee, was dismissed from the team by coach Derek Dooley in June after a rocky tenure in Knoxville that included multiple violations of team rules under Dooley and previous coach Lane Kiffin.
